预览加载中,请您耐心等待几秒...
1/3
2/3
3/3

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

面向数据中心负载的缓存策略研究及针对SSD的扩展与优化的任务书 任务书 一、任务背景 随着数据中心规模的不断扩大和数据量的增加,数据中心中存在着大量的读写操作,这些读写操作会对数据的存储和读取速度造成一定的影响。为了提升数据的存储和读取效率,数据中心中经常采用缓存策略来缓解存储瓶颈和提升读取效率。 目前,数据中心中采用的缓存策略主要包括本地缓存和分布式缓存。本地缓存是指将数据存储在本地节点中,可以在节点之间实现数据共享和数据迁移。分布式缓存是指将数据存储在分布式节点中,可以在多个节点之间实现数据分发和负载均衡。 本地缓存和分布式缓存都可以提升数据的存储和读取效率,但是它们存在一些局限性。本地缓存的数据量有限,当数据量增加时,会出现存储不足的情况。分布式缓存需要协调各个节点之间的数据同步和数据迁移,造成了额外的系统开销。 为了解决缓存策略存在的局限性,当前研究采用了SSD扩展来优化缓存策略。通过将数据迁移到SSD中,可以扩大数据的存储量,提升读取速度,同时减少缓存策略的开销。 二、任务目标 本次任务的主要目标是研究面向数据中心负载的缓存策略,并针对SSD进行扩展与优化。 具体任务包括: 1.分析当前数据中心中使用的缓存策略,评估其优缺点和适用范围。 2.研究SSD的存储原理和性能特点,探索将其应用于缓存策略的可行性。 3.针对SSD的存储特点和性能优势,提出针对性的缓存策略,并通过实验对策略的有效性和性能进行评估。 4.研究如何减少数据迁移对系统性能的影响,提出优化算法,并通过实验对算法的有效性和性能进行评估。 5.撰写课程设计报告,阐述任务目标、研究方法、实验结果及意义等。 三、任务流程 1.文献综述阶段:通过收集相关文献,理解数据中心中采用的缓存策略及其优缺点,研究SSD的存储原理和性能特点。 2.设计阶段:基于文献综述阶段的分析和研究,提出针对性的缓存策略和优化算法。 3.实现阶段:使用开发工具实现缓存策略和优化算法,并进行系统测试和性能评估。 4.总结阶段:分析实验结果,撰写课程设计报告。 四、任务要求 1.完成任务的过程中,要充分理解文献中的内容,准确把握任务要求; 2.完成任务报告撰写,每个参与者需撰写至少3000字的课程设计报告; 3.任务完成后,参与者应与指导老师进行沟通和交流,及时了解和反馈任务进展情况。 五、参考文献 [1]魏琴.数据中心缓存方案的研究与实现[J].电脑知识与技术,2016,12(34):129-131. [2]王俊.基于Redis的分布式缓存技术研究[J].计算机应用技术与发展,2018,01:48-52. [3]ZouX,JiangY,LvZ,etal.UsingSolid-StateDriveasaHybridCacheforFileSystem[J].JournalofSoftware,2013,24(9):1887-1902. [4]AfsariK,CyriacJ,KitsuregawaM.ReactiveOnlineDataAnalyticswithApproximateCachingonSSDs[C]//Proceedingsofthe2017ACMInternationalConferenceonManagementofData,2017:133-146. [5]XuZ,WangN.OptimizingSolidStateDrive-basedCachePerformanceforVirtualizedStorageSystems[C]//Proceedingsofthe2016USENIXAnnualTechnicalConference,2016:181-193.